What I Would Check Before Buying
Before making an offer, I would personally review:
- Property condition and age of major systems
- Recent comparable sales in the area
- Property taxes and monthly carrying costs
- School district quality, if relevant to my needs
- Commute time to work, transit, and highways
- Neighborhood noise, traffic, and overall upkeep
My Budget Considerations
I would not just focus on the purchase price. I would also calculate closing costs, insurance, taxes, maintenance, and any renovation expenses. In my experience, a property can look affordable at first, but the true cost becomes clear only when I add everything together.
